SUMMARY

As a key member of the Regional Exploration team the Senior Exploration Geologist will be responsible for assuming a strategic role in leadership and direction of near mine, district, and regional exploration activities. The Senior Exploration Geologist will work in a fast-paced, demanding, dynamic and results-driven atmosphere. Adherence and promotion of all applicable safety, environmental and regulatory requirements is mandatory. The Senior Exploration Geologist will supervise, mentor, and advise the exploration staff team members and contractors to ensure business plans are achieved. Position-specific requirements may include generation and supervision of near mine and district drill targets, geologic mapping and sampling, budget preparation, reporting, project management, planning geophysical surveys and generation of systematic and detailed geologic maps, cross-sections, and geologic modeling. The Senior Exploration Geologist is responsible for geological activities related to exploration as directed by the Director of Exploration and Geology.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following. Other duties may be assigned.

•Ensure safe work environment and all required and applicable best practices are followed by mine employees, contractors, and visitors

•Ensure compliance with all regulatory requirements

•Supervise and mentors' direct reports

•Leads regional geological interpretations

•Detailed geologic mapping and sampling

•Generation of geologic maps, cross-sections, geologic models, and presentation material as needed utilizing Vulcan and ArcGIS

•Budget, plan and execute exploration and surface or underground based drilling programs

•Log and sample drill core and chips

•Contribute to the creation and revision of NI 43-101-compliant resource models

•Collect, provide, and interpret geologic data as needed

EDUCATION and/or EXPERIENCE

•Bachelor's Degree in Geology required, Master's Degree in Geology, structural or epithermal focus preferred

•4-7 years of applicable experience preferred (low sulfidation, epithermal deposits preferred)

•Excellent safety record, self-motivated and leadership

•Proficiency in appropriate software required, experience in Vulcan and ArcGIS are highly preferred
